HomeSort by relevance Sort by last modified time
    Searched defs:CSRegs (Results 1 - 6 of 6) sorted by null

  /external/llvm/lib/Target/ARM/
Thumb1FrameLowering.cpp 305 static bool isCSRestore(MachineInstr *MI, const MCPhysReg *CSRegs) {
308 isCalleeSavedRegister(MI->getOperand(0).getReg(), CSRegs))
314 if (!isCalleeSavedRegister(MI->getOperand(i).getReg(), CSRegs))
339 const MCPhysReg *CSRegs = RegInfo->getCalleeSavedRegs(&MF);
350 while (MBBI != MBB.begin() && isCSRestore(MBBI, CSRegs));
351 if (!isCSRestore(MBBI, CSRegs))
ARMFrameLowering.cpp 94 const MCPhysReg *CSRegs) {
100 if (!isCalleeSavedRegister(MI->getOperand(i).getReg(), CSRegs))
107 isCalleeSavedRegister(MI->getOperand(0).getReg(), CSRegs) &&
762 const MCPhysReg *CSRegs = RegInfo->getCalleeSavedRegs(&MF);
766 } while (MBBI != MBB.begin() && isCSRestore(MBBI, TII, CSRegs));
767 if (!isCSRestore(MBBI, TII, CSRegs))
    [all...]
ARMBaseInstrInfo.cpp     [all...]
  /external/llvm/lib/Target/SystemZ/
SystemZFrameLowering.cpp 96 const MCPhysReg *CSRegs = TRI->getCalleeSavedRegs(&MF);
97 for (unsigned I = 0; CSRegs[I]; ++I) {
98 unsigned Reg = CSRegs[I];
  /external/llvm/lib/CodeGen/
PrologEpilogInserter.cpp 296 const MCPhysReg *CSRegs = RegInfo->getCalleeSavedRegs(&F);
303 if (!CSRegs || CSRegs[0] == 0)
311 for (unsigned i = 0; CSRegs[i]; ++i) {
312 unsigned Reg = CSRegs[i];
    [all...]
  /external/llvm/lib/Target/AArch64/
AArch64FrameLowering.cpp 504 static bool isCalleeSavedRegister(unsigned Reg, const MCPhysReg *CSRegs) {
505 for (unsigned i = 0; CSRegs[i]; ++i)
506 if (Reg == CSRegs[i])
511 static bool isCSRestore(MachineInstr *MI, const MCPhysReg *CSRegs) {
520 if (!isCalleeSavedRegister(MI->getOperand(RtIdx).getReg(), CSRegs) ||
521 !isCalleeSavedRegister(MI->getOperand(RtIdx + 1).getReg(), CSRegs) ||
599 const MCPhysReg *CSRegs = RegInfo->getCalleeSavedRegs(&MF);
604 } while (LastPopI != MBB.begin() && isCSRestore(LastPopI, CSRegs));
605 if (!isCSRestore(LastPopI, CSRegs)) {
    [all...]

Completed in 934 milliseconds